The Florida Department of Health is entering into a single-source contract with Docufree, formerly Image API, LLC, for the renewal of the Axiom Pro Software as a Service subscription, including ongoing maintenance, upgrades, enhancements, and technical support. This procurement is justified under Chapter 60A-1.045 of the Florida Administrative Code, which permits non-competitive acquisition when services are only available from a single source due to proprietary system dependencies. The Axiom Pro platform is integral to the department’s electronic document management system, requiring continuity of operations and seamless integration with existing infrastructure, making Docufree the sole provider capable of sustaining the system. The total contract value is $630,000, with no itemized line items, options, or negotiation involved, as the price is accepted as quoted by the sole vendor. The place of performance is throughout Florida, with administrative oversight centered at the department’s Tallahassee location. No competitive evaluation, technical scoring, or evaluation factors are applicable due to the non-competitive nature of the acquisition. The solicitation was posted on May 4, 2026, with a submission deadline the same day, and responses must be submitted in physical form via mail or hand delivery to the Agency Clerk at the specified Tallahassee address; electronic submissions, including email, are explicitly rejected. The Florida Department of Health, Bureau of Communicable Diseases, HIV/AIDS Section, is soliciting applications under RFA 26-003 for the Targeted Outreach for Pregnant Women Act (TOPWA) for fiscal year 2027. This initiative aims to reduce perinatal HIV transmission and address healthcare disparities for pregnant individuals, particularly those with substance use disorders or limited prenatal care access. The program focuses on early identification, engagement, and linkage to care, aligning with High-Impact Prevention and Ending the HIV Epidemic priorities. Key deliverables include implementing outreach plans, providing HIV, HBV, and HCV testing, linking newly diagnosed patients to medical care within 30 calendar days, and hosting annual community baby showers. The anticipated contract period begins January 1, 2027, with a total duration of three years, subject to annual funding availability. Approximately 1,000,000 dollars in annual funding is available. Applications are evaluated on a 120-point scale, with the highest weights given to the program proposal, statement of need, staffing and organizational capacity, and budget. Eligible applicants must be non-profit or 501(c)(3) organizations and provide comprehensive documentation, including a detailed budget, organizational charts, and key personnel resumes. Submissions must be electronic, following strict formatting and page limit guidelines, and are due by September 30, 2026. Awardees must adhere to the Florida Department of Health's non-negotiable Standard Contract and comply with various federal civil rights and non-discrimination regulations.
